  1. SkyMaxx Pro is not a weather injector. It only reads what X-Plane fetches, so something like this will either come from Laminar or a different product!

  7. Likely not. Cirrus clouds are generally quite high, and traditionally thin overall. We're focused on performance, and the current cirrus solution works just fine for that. We'll keep it in mind if we ever find ways to get more optimizations in, but again, I wouldn't bank on this one.
